Technical field
The utility model is related to detection device technology field, specially a kind of multi-function metal material testing apparatus.
Background technology
Multi-function metal material testing apparatus is the machine for being detected to metal, and metal material detection range is related to Measuring mechanical property and chemical composition analysis, metallographic point to ferrous metal, non-ferrous metal, mechanical equipment and parts etc. Analysis, precise measure measurement, nondestructive inspection, corrosion resistance test and environmental simulation test etc., but present detection device is using When, the case where cannot be fixed well to metal, metal is caused to shake in the detection, to be carried out to metal It accurately detects, prodigious trouble is caused to staff.
Utility model content
(1) the technical issues of solving
In view of the deficiencies of the prior art, the utility model provides a kind of multi-function metal material testing apparatus, solves Detection device when in use, the case where cannot be fixed well to metal, metal is caused to shake in the detection, to The problem of metal cannot accurately being detected, very burden is caused to staff.

In use, first metal material is placed on the first magnet 4, make the first magnet 4 by the bottom of metal material Be sucked, it be fixed, then by rotate the first screw rod 6 make plectane 7 drive connecting rod 8 in the opening in the outside of wooden barrel 2 on Lower movement is adjusted the height of metal material, then passes through pulling to make the first magnet 4 be moved with connecting rod 8 Fixed ring makes pressing plate 23 elongate expansion plate 22, then rotates the second screw rod 12 and pushes fixed plate 13, fixed plate 13 is made to squeeze the One spring 14 pushes bent plate 15, and then slab 21 will resist on the left of metal material, makes to be against limit on the right side of metal material On plate 10, it is rotated further the second screw rod 12, makes to start to squeeze slab 21 on the left of metal material, to which slab 21 is by the Two telescopic rods 18 compress, make curved bar 19 start to be moved to the left with the second telescopic rod 18, then baffle 20 with curved bar 19 move, Then the second magnet 17 is attracted by metal material, and second spring 16 is elongated, and the second magnet 17 is made to be adsorbed on metal On material, metal material is further fixed, fixed ring is then unclamped, makes pressing plate 23 as the recovery of expansion plate 22 is to moving down It is dynamic, since the weight of briquetting 25 is more than the weight of framework 27, after being pushed down at the top of metal material to briquetting 25, make sponge ring 24 are compressed, and then framework 27 pulls steel wire rope 29 that hose 26 is made to start to restore elongated, and then the top of the inside of framework 27 will be golden Belong to and being pushed down at the top of material, then third magnet 28 is attracted by metal material, and the attraction to be detached from iron plate is adsorbed on On metal material, then further metal material is fixed, the personnel of working at the same time can open the switch on 32 right side of water pipe, Make the water inside water tank 31 flow out to clean the surface of metal material, then water passes through the first magnet along metal material Circular hole outflow on 4, then flowed into workbench 1 by the perforation on workbench 1, since the both sides perforation of workbench 1 is connected with Bend pipe, last water are discharged by the bend pipe of 1 both sides of workbench, and it is effectively solid to ensure that detection device can carry out metal material It is fixed, while the content not being described in detail in this specification belongs to the prior art well known to professional and technical personnel in the field.
